I'd like to know if there is any migration path for workflows provided by other products to Activiti. Specifically I am looking to convert our existing workflow process designed using ITIM 5.1 (IBM Tivoli Identity Manager) to Activiti.

Has any one performed this kind of migration yet ?

Hi,

The challenge would be to convert this workflow definition into a BPMN 2.0 process definition.
If you send me an example of a "simple" process I can see how much effort would be needed.
I'm not aware of somebody that has performed this exact migration.
